This dataset contains geoscientific data logged during PACLARK 2 (FR01/88) cruise on RV Franklin 8-28 January 1988 in Western Woodlark Basin and Goodenough Bay,Papua New Guinea. These data include logged station coordinates and information for CTD/hydrocasts, dredges, sediment cores, bathymetric surveys and camera tows. Please see the associated cruise report for details. Cruise FR 01/88 was undertaken to locate evidence of hydrothermal activity in the Western Woodlark Basin (east of Papua New Guinea) and Goodenough Bay, and to map submarine geology in an area of ocean ridge propagation into a continental margin. Survey methods included bathymetric profiling, magnetometer surveys, dredgers and gravity corers, a deep-tow camera system, and CTD casts with other associated instrumentation including a transmissometer. Numerous rock, sediment and water samples were collected for laboratory study. Related cruises are FR 02/86, FR 08/91, HMAS Cook - PACLARK III and RV Akademik Mstislav Keldysh and MIR submersibles - SUPACLARK.
